2  .WS Business / Marketing / Re: Leads that you buy. on: November 07, 2005, 05:31:48 AM
Yeah Troy,

I've purchased some of the leads as well from the back office but, ironically enough, I GET the sign-ups when I go the direct mail route with them.  Their put into the email system by GDI but I get very little "open" rates.  Being that we also get the snail-mail address though, I'll just drop a personalized (MS Word Mail Merge) letter to the list and that turns over about 2-4% when I do that.

Hope that helps.

3  .WS Services / Showcase Your Website / Sharing my website! Oh YEAH!! on: October 29, 2005, 07:00:22 PM
A friend of mine and I decided to do something community related with this GDI opportunity.  We created http://www.MyReunion.ws - a website for our local Colorado community to advertise their personal businesses or services.  After attending the recreation center for our home area we noticed that all sorts of people were doing all sorts of businesses.  Everything from walking dogs, teaching music, construction, painting, and much much more but they were all tacked to this cork board in such disaray you'd find yourself twisting and lifting and peeking under larger flyers to get a look at the smaller ones so hence - www.MyReunion.ws !!!  Reunion by the way is a great community in Commerce City, CO that has brought all of the aminities anybody could ever ask for in one place  -  golf, running tracks, pools, weight gym, basket-ball, I mean it's all here.  Keeping in-line with this layout my friend and I decided to make an "everything right HERE" type of website for our neighbors and community.

We're very proud of it!  By the way it was made with a simple "WYSIWYG" (What You See Is What You Get) program that cost us about $40 bucks.  Site Builder 3.0 is GREAT too, however, this was also a lesson for the two of us in HTML since we were able to view the code after we were finished with the site to see which code does what, (in case anyone was curious about learning a little about HTML)


Thanks for reading my post.  Hope it contributes to the idea-pool as one MORE useful way to use your GDI opportunity to expose people to it's AWESOME-ness!!!
